I quite like 4-3-3 as a formation. It can keep you solid in midfield whilst still getting 3 players forward. But to work well you need the right players and we don't have those.

You need a goal threat from each of the front 3. At least two need to be strikers who can play out wide, rather than more traditional wingers - the sort of player you'd put upfront in a 4-4-2. Ideally they would also be the kind of players who can make goals out of nothing. And best of all, they would be able to interchange across the front 3 during the course of the game. Bit of pace doesn't hurt either.

Of our current players, arguably only Tollitt fits it at all (he is a goal threat and can make things happen on his own) and he isn't really a striker. Whereas in 2011/12, when we played the system best, Speight, Wright, Pogba and Morrell were all strikers who could play wide (the latter less so, but he could do a job).

So we have players upfront who seem more to be bodies to keep us solid, rather than make anything happen. Rutherford, for example, would seem likely to be more effective as a wide player in a 4-4-2. Grant doesn't fit in at all. Stockton and Oswell just seem like traditional strikers.
